What needs a lot of Tritanium/Pyerite and not many other minerals?

It needs to be a big mod, not like smal hull rep or so. I would like to transport millions of units and need to compress it.

Tekota
The Freighter Factory
#2 - 2011-11-07 00:23:12 UTC
Fusion XL ammo might be a good bet, Trit, Pye & Mex.
Failing that, 800mm arties might get better compression but you're adding more minerals to the mix.
